{"object":[{"sourceId":{"label":"Source ID","value":"19131"},"creditline":{"label":"Credit Line","value":"Ankauf aus Mitteln der Galerienförderung des Bundes"},"invno":{"label":"Inventory number","value":"10248"},"description":{"label":"Description","value":"Combining technical savvy with playful ease, Verena Dengler makes installations based on the visual vocabulary of both high and popular culture, incorporating snippets of avant-garde art as well as designer objects and everyday implements. Interspersed between them are references to artisan craftwork, as in \u201cSculpture for Camilla Birke and Maria Likarz (Wiener Werkstätte).\u201d The assemblage of objects is dedicated to the long-forgotten artists named in the title, associates of the Vienna Workshop, in its time an influential and successful creative venture. In Dengler\u2019s meditation on recollection and contemporary recreation, on appropriation and upward revaluation, a knitted picture with patterns drafted by the two designers encounters a modified CD rack."},"medium":{"label":"Medium","value":"CD stand, fabric, plaster, silkscreen, embroidered picture"},"onview":{"label":"On View","value":"0"},"title":{"label":"Title","value":"[Skulpture For Camilla Birke And Maria Likarz (Viennese Workshops)]"},"classification":{"label":"Genre","value":"Object art"},"primaryMedia":{"label":"PrimaryMedia","value":"/internal/media/dispatcher/102002/full"},"displayDate":{"label":"Date","value":"2009"},"id":{"label":"Id","value":"10199345"},"iiifManifest":{"value":"https://sammlungtest.belvedere.at/apis/iiif/presentation/v2/1-objects-19131/manifest"},"dimensions":{"label":"Dimensions","value":"155 × 51 × 35 cm"}}]}
